Does Kinder Elite Academy II have a state child-care violation history?

Texas HHSC records list 9 child-care citations for Kinder Elite Academy II in ATLANTA, TX. The state assigns each cited standard a risk level; for this facility, 2 are recorded at the High level and 3 at Medium High, with the remainder at Medium, Medium Low, or Low. Each entry below reproduces the standard Texas cited and the state's own description of what was found.

These are licensing-record findings, not a judgment about any child or family. The dates shown are the dates Texas recorded a correction as verified — they are not inspection dates, and the record may lag the state's current file. This page reflects the published record as of its last update and is not a complete history; the authoritative source is Texas HHSC.

  1. Correction verified July 17, 2025High

    746.305(a)(6) - Report Situation Placing Children at Risk

    This standard was reviewed as part of an investigation and found non-compliant. It was discovered during the investigation that the operation did not report timely when they became aware of two separate incidents at the operation that placed a child at risk.

  2. Correction verified July 17, 2025High

    746.307(b)(4) - Parental Communication - Situation that Placed a Child at Risk

    This standard was reviewed as part of an investigation and found non-compliant. During the investigation it was discovered that a child who had been threatened with harm by a staff had not been notified by the operation for six days after incident.

  3. Correction verified June 8, 2026Medium High

    746.3501(1) - Diaper Changing Steps- Prompt

    This standard was reviewed as part of an investigation and found non-compliant based on information obtained. It was discovered that a child was not changed promptly when the child told the caregiver that they needed to be changed.

  1. Correction verified July 17, 2025Medium High

    746.2803(4) - Discipline - Positive Methods of Discipline and Guidance

    This standard was reviewed as part of an investigation and found non-compliant. It was discovered that the same child was threatened by two different staff with harm to them.

  2. Correction verified November 16, 2021Medium High

    746.605(6) - Required Admission Information - Emergency Contact

    Four of six children's files reviewed at inspection was lacking a complete address for their emergency contact person.

  3. Correction verified August 5, 2025Medium

    746.603(a) - Children's Records Maintained

    Four of six children's files were lacking all the compents required in their children records requirements. A list of children and missing information was left with operation.

  4. Correction verified July 18, 2025Medium

    746.2421(b) - Written Feeding Instructions - Review and Update Every 30 Days

    All infants requiring feeding instructions had not been update in over 30-45 days.

  5. Correction verified November 16, 2021Medium

    746.611(a)(3) - Health Statement parent sign - Dated within past yr, name/address health care professional, states child can participate. Follow by signed statement

    Four of six children's files reviewed were lacking a complete address for a health professional who has examined the child in past year.

  6. Correction verified November 16, 2021Medium

    746.605(11) - Required Admission Information - Physician Information

    Three of six children's files reviewed was lacking a complete name, address and phone number for either the physician or medical facility.
